Exposure is a funny and poignant memoir of adventure and love with a sharp psychological edge. Joel Magarey, a young journalist haunted by both inflated dreams and obsessive-compulsive disorder, abandons his career and girlfriend of seven years for a long-imagined global odyssey - and unimagined perils. Travel tale, love story and generation-X tragicomedy, Exposure is about wanting and fearing too much, choosing too little and how a person can spend three weeks solid in Los Angeles searching for the perfect sleeping bag. 'A striking and substantial book, at once compelling, scary, delightfully comic and moving.' - Tom Shapcott 'The misadventures of the young Joel, erotic and otherwise, during an odyssey to some of the remoter corners of the world, are related with wry honesty.' - J.M. Coetzee 'An extraordinary story ...wry, honest, amusing and evocative.' - Eva Hornung
